Would make 1st level Rage grant +4 str, +4 Con, +2 attack with ranged weapons, and -2 ac.
The Exceptional pull aspect would make your composite weapons (longbow and shortbow) adjust to account for your increase in strength due to rage.
Putting them together: with a base 14 strength, your composite longbow (+2 strength rating) would deal 1d8+2 without rage, and deal 1d8+4 with rage (and a +2 modifier to hit).
Otherwise, a normal barbarian with a composite weapon is left with a choice between one that doesn't add increased strength during a rage, or one that is -2 to attack because it has a higher strength rating that your barbarian does when they aren't raging.
